Foreword

The many lakes along the NSW coast generate ecological, social and economic benefits that are enjoyed by thestate community, as well as by the local communities that live, work or play near them. Unfortunately, one ofthe features common to coastal lakes is that we are placing increasingly intolerable demands on them. Manyare now highly degraded while only one remains in a truly pristine condition. It is not only the environmentalvalues of coastal lakes that are being threatened. The various human activities that depend on ‘healthy lakes’,such as tourism, fishing and oyster growing, are also being placed at risk.

There are so many public authorities making decisions and undertaking activities that affect coastal lakes thatit could be said that they are under the management of almost ‘everyone’, but under the effective‘guardianship’ of no one. There also is currently no agreed system for ensuring that decisions pay sufficientregard to the limitations of coastal lakes and their catchments. Similarly, there has been no agreed process fordetermining the desired outcomes for individual lakes or resolving conflicts among competing interests.

These trends cannot be allowed to continue. This Inquiry by the Healthy Rivers Commission has left no doubtthat citizens expect strong and decisive action, by all levels of government, to protect remaining values,contain further damage and undertake targeted repair with a sensible ordering of priorities. A central themeof the Inquiry’s findings and recommendations is that ‘healthier lakes’ will be achievable only if there is afundamental change in the ways decisions are made.

The Commission advocates that the existing powers of decision makers must be applied with more rigour andon the basis of better information. The Commission has not suggested the creation of new regulatory powers,the imposition of a new range of restrictions on the rights of citizens or the curtailment of the roles of councils.The recommendations of this Inquiry, presented as a Coastal Lakes Strategy: An Assessment and ManagementFramework, are designed to assist those so empowered to make decisions affecting lakes that are better,stronger, more timely and effective over time.

I therefore welcome the NSW Government's recent Action for the Environment: Environment Statement 2001 andthe Coastal Protection Package. The latter package provides for a Comprehensive Coastal Assessment that willencompass assessments of coastal lakes and their catchments, as proposed in this Inquiry Report. In its Actionfor the Environment Statement, the Government has noted its intention to implement recommendations fromthis Inquiry as a means of protecting the fragile ecosystems of coastal lakes.

The Commission has drawn on the advice of many citizens and that of acknowledged experts, in preparing itsstrategy for improving the health of coastal lakes. The submissions received in response to the Commission'sdraft findings and recommendations demonstrated strong support with few exceptions. In fact, a number ofsubmissions moved beyond the content of the recommended strategy for managing coastal lakes to addressmatters relating to its implementation and its potential extension to other estuaries.

The approach advocated by the Commission relates to all of the coastal lakes. While greater urgency appliesin some particular cases (such as in the Shoalhaven and Great Lakes regions), there is everywhere a need toensure that current and future decisions begin to ‘turn the tide’ and ensure that the remaining values of thesenatural assets are maintained.

The Coastal Lakes Strategy presents a pilot application of an integrated approach for managing natural resourceand land use planning, particularly in terms of creating a context for assessing resource capabilities anddetermining and implementing management actions. The experience gained through preparing SustainabilityAssessments and Management Plans for coastal lakes in the Shoalhaven and Great Lakes areas, in the firstinstance, would inform the wider application of the Coastal Protection Package.

I thank everyone who has been involved in this Inquiry for their participation and encourage anyone with aninterest in coastal lakes to get behind the implementation of the Coastal Lakes Strategy. I also wish to thankProfessor Bruce Thom, Chair of the Coastal Council of NSW for his commentary during the development ofthe strategy. The Commission looks forward to auditing the progress made by public authorities toimplement the strategy two years after the Government announces its response to this Final Report.

Coastal Lakes: Facing the Challenge

1 Fundamental Realities

The independent Coastal Lakes Inquiry,undertaken by the Healthy Rivers Commission,identified and confirmed several fundamentalrealities that must be faced in our efforts to improvethe health of coastal lakes.

Many coastal lakes are treated as if they havelimitless capacity to support human activities.

The evidence is clear enough on that point —whether assessed in terms of community orscientific opinion. For example, the 1997contamination of oyster growing waters in WallisLake, with its public health implications, providedgraphic evidence of the failure to recognise thelimitations of natural systems. It demonstrated thatan insufficient understanding of the impacts ofdevelopment has compromised not only theecological condition of some coastal lakes, but alsothe continuing viability of some commercialactivities that are dependent on healthy coastallakes. Other typical examples include:

• the occurrence of blue green algal blooms inLake Ainsworth and Myall Lake — whichphenomenon can only be rectified in the longerterm;

• the impacts of significant urban areas in thecatchments of coastal lakes and the oftenenormous remedial costs, as is the case forManly, Curl Curl, and Macquarie lakes;

• the emergence of proposals to develop newurban and rural residential areas in thecatchments of several highly sensitive coastallakes, where the current assessment of theimpacts on lake ecosystems or the humanactivities that are dependent on it, has beeninadequate, for example, in Burrill, Merimbulaand Cudgen lakes and St Georges Basin;

• the inevitable demand to construct major worksto 'repair' some coastal lakes wheredevelopment pressures have been significant,such as the construction of a permanententrance to 'ventilate' Lake Illawarra, therebyfurther changing the character of a lake'secosystem and resource base; and

• the common practices for opening the entrancesof many coastal lakes, regardless of thesignificant differences in their ecosystemcondition, conservation value and the scale ofhuman assets subject to inundation at highwater levels - for example, the near pristineDurras Lake and the highly developed TerrigalLagoon are both opened artificially.

The resulting problems generally can be attributedto a lack of credible assessments of the humanactivities that coastal lakes can sustain, a lack ofclarity in the outcomes sought for each lake, a lackof processes to ensure balanced decision making, alack of consistency in management actions and alack of accountability for the decisions affectinglakes. In many instances, there is a combination ofall five shortcomings.

Citizens and their governments face afundamental choice regarding the naturalecosystems of coastal lakes.

Only one coastal lake in New South Wales remainsin truly pristine condition. Nadgee Lagoon situatedon the far south coast, survives today not becauseof a conscious decision to protect it but because thelake and its catchment were not developed byEuropean settlers. For other coastal lakes theavailable choices are now extremely limited by theinheritance of past decisions, such as those thatallowed inappropriate patterns of urban and ruraldevelopment in sensitive lake catchments, locatedassets in areas prone to water inundation when lakewater levels are high, or situated homes inforeshore areas that are exposed to pungent odours.

The condition of coastal lakes ranges from ‘nearpristine’ to ‘highly modified’. There is someopportunity to 'hold the line' or even restore coastallakes that are in a near pristine condition, such asDurras Lake. However, this would requireimmediate action to place the natural ecologicalhealth of these coastal lakes at the centre of futureplanning and management decisions.

Protection in a relatively pristine condition remainsa viable option for some coastal lakes, and for themthe choice may be between various levels ofprotection. For most lakes, however, the only choicenow is between acceptance of the limitationsinherent in more sustainable management andacceptance of significant further damage, whichwill be often irreversible.

The inevitability of those choices must berecognised in all planning and decision makingrelating to coastal lakes. In order to make informedchoices, public authorities and citizens requirecredible assessments of lakes’ capacities, andprocesses for understanding the possible trade- offsand choosing among them.

Coastal lakes are the most sensitive of allestuaries to human interventions.

This sensitivity largely relates to the geomorphiccharacter of coastal lakes. Sensitivity is greatest incoastal lakes that have entrances that are mostlyclosed or have irregular shapes, due to the limitedexchange of fresh or saline water moving through alake.

Human interventions, such as the entry ofwastewater from urban areas and the artificialopening of entrances, can have profound impactson the ecology of coastal lakes. Further, thesesystems are terminal sinks for many contaminants,which present particular challenges for waterquality management.2

The ecosystems of many coastal lakes displaypronounced natural ‘boom and bust’ variations(both spatially and temporally). For example, therecorded levels of total nitrogen in LakeWollumboola range between 5 and 24,000micrograms per litre.

Each coastal lake is unique in its ecology, humanvalues and interrelationships.

Although they vary so much, the prevailingmanagement approach has tended to treat coastallakes as if these are all the same or even that theyare all like well-flushed estuaries, such as SydneyHarbour. That is, decisions about land uses,fishing, roads, forestry, sewerage and the openingsof lake entrances have given little attention to thenatural differences in coastal lakes, their varyingsensitivity to human uses or the dependencies ofhuman uses on healthy lakes. Much degradationhas resulted.

Some coastal lakes have broadly similargeomorphic characteristics, but significantlydifferent capacities to assimilate pollutants, as is thecase for Manly and Curl Curl lagoons. Humanvalues that are dependent on the ecosystems of

individual coastal lakes often vary markedly, asdemonstrated by differing patterns of tourism,fishing, oyster cultivation and settlement.

In other cases, human activities have createdmodified conditions that are highly valued. Forexample, the creation of a more 'stable' salt waterenvironment in Wallis Lake, through theconstruction of a permanent entrance, has createdconditions more favourable for oyster cultivation.Similarly, relationships have evolved betweenvarious coastal lakes and rivers.3

Such ecosystem and human relationships arepoorly understood. Appropriate assessments havenot been undertaken for most coastal lakes, despitethe acknowledged value of these systems asenvironmental assets to regional economies andtheir contribution to community well being.Additionally, many natural resource managementplans address specific matters, rather than dealingcomprehensively with the ways in which coastallakes are affected by the interplay between broaderecosystem processes and human activities.

The opportunity to restore coastal lakes that arehighly modified has generally now passed.

In managing all natural systems it is oftentechnically more difficult and financiallyprohibitive to mount restoration efforts rather thanprotection efforts. This is particularly true ofcoastal lakes. Once conditions in a coastal lakehave passed certain threshold levels, such as criticallevels of nutrient enrichment, the managementchallenges are greatly magnified. For example, theoccurrence of blue green algal blooms in LakeAinsworth has led to a requirement for mechanicalaeration of the water body, at significant cost, toreduce the release of nutrients accumulated in lakesediments.

For some highly modified lakes, such as Manly andDee Why lagoons, restoration to a near pristinecondition is now widely accepted as an unrealisticgoal, given the dramatic changes to existingpatterns of development that would be required.

However, even the most degraded coastal lakesoffer some opportunity to move towards a healthiermodified system. Citizens clearly expect that actionwill be taken in that regard. The challenge is to

identify the most realistic strategies to achieveuseful improvements, at tolerable cost.

There are divergent views about the 'best' ways tomanage coastal lakes.

Local citizens, visitors and the broader statecommunity engage in many debates about the bestways to manage coastal lakes. Differing views areoften based on perceptions and personalexperiences, captured in comments such as: 'thereused to be lots of fish until the entrance closed/opened','opening the entrance will solve odour problems', and'commercial/recreational fishers take all the fish'. Insome instances, community views have beenstrongly divided and key differences remainunresolved, as is the case for Wollumboola andCathie lakes.

Many people involved in managing coastal lakesbelieve that a lack of access to independent andhigh quality expertise on coastal lake processes andmanagement, and a lack of processes to ensurebalanced decision making and to mediate disputes,undermine efforts to gain the trust and support ofcitizens.

Emerging pressures present new threats andopportunities for coastal lakes, depending on howthese are managed.

Areas around coastal lakes are highly sought afterplaces to live, work and play. New developmentprovides some opportunity to drive remedialactions, by providing additional revenue forfunding works such as reticulated sewerage toexisting urban areas and/or raising the level ofbuildings in flood prone areas. However, care mustbe taken to ensure that ‘the cure’ is not counter-productive. For example, the creation of additionalsources of stormwater contaminants from newurban areas could offset much of the benefitachieved by sewering older areas.

New proposals, such as aquaculture, fish stocking,plantation forestry and recreational activitieswarrant careful assessment to determine whetherthese can be sustained by the ecosystems of coastallakes, and whether these are compatible with othervalued human activities.

2 Pre-Conditions for Effective Management

Improved planning and management of coastallakes is urgent. It will take time and resources toovercome existing problems and to reversedeteriorating trends in lake health. 'Goodmanagement' must balance the future health of lakeecosystems, the needs of people whose activities aredependent on it and the interests of others.

The Coastal Lakes Inquiry identified several pre-conditions for securing the health of coastal lakes.

A stronger overall framework is required todetermine the orientation of management decisionsand the type of strategies for managing coastallakes. The framework must ensure that there isbetter recognition of the unique ecosystems andhuman values of each coastal lake, and of eachlake’s capability to support human activities. Theremust be credible and practical requirements andprocesses for assessing the capabilities (andlimitations) of coastal lakes and their catchments.Management decisions must be informed by thefindings of those assessments.

Appropriate planning tools, sufficient powers,resources and relevant specialist expertise must, ofcourse, be available to councils and agencies so thatthey can exercise their natural resourcemanagement responsibilities more effectively.Community awareness and education strategiesmust provide citizens with sound informationabout the key ecological processes, human activitiesand their interrelationships with coastal lakes, aswell as offering effective ways for citizens toparticipate in decision making.

There must be more skilful selection and use of themanagement 'tools' best able to achieve theoutcomes sought for each coastal lake. State agencyand council programs must be designed anddelivered in ways that are consistent and mutuallyreinforcing, through careful specification of thepriorities and design criteria for matters such assewerage and stormwater works, road construction,fisheries, plantation forestry and mining. Aneffective management framework would enhancemanagers’ efforts to make the best choices.

Finally, efforts to improve the health of coastallakes must be backed by effective accountabilityarrangements. The framework must provide aplatform against which the actions of agencies,councils, developers and interest groups can beaudited by an independent entity, and duediligence demonstrated.

6 Management Framework

It is both necessary and possible to group thecoastal lakes into broad classes that share someimportant characteristics, in terms of their currentand desired conditions, the constraints andopportunities associated with them, and the typicalmanagement actions most likely to achieve thedesired outcomes.7

The central component of the Coastal Lakes Strategyis a framework that is specifically designed torecognise the important differences among coastallakes that necessitate different management actions.

Each coastal lake is classified into one of fourclasses: Comprehensive Protection, SignificantProtection, Healthy Modified Conditions orTargeted Repair. For each class, the frameworkprovides guidance as to:

• the orientation, or underlying intention, ofmanagement decisions;

• the scope of Sustainability Assessment andManagement Plans required to refine theoutcomes sought and indicative actions;

• the intended outcomes of decisions, that is, theresults that would, ultimately, indicate successor failure;

• the indicative types of actions most suited toeach class of coastal lake; and

• the selection and use of the management 'tools'most appropriate to implementing the actions.

The classification of each coastal lake is the startingpoint for the design of an effective managementplan for each lake.

While providing a context for decision making on aclass by class basis for the various lakeclassifications, the framework requires recognitionof variations within the classes. It providessufficient flexibility for actions to be fine-tuned, inlight of the results of Sustainability Assessment and

7 For technical details, see Roy,P.S., Williams,R.J., Jones,A.R.,

Yassini,I., Gibbs,P.J.,West,R.J., Coates,B.P., Scanes,P.R.,Hudson,J.P. & Nichol,S., Structure and Function of SoutheastAustralian Estuaries, (2001) in Estuarine, Coastal & Shelf Science;Vol. 53, No. 3, 1/9/01; Harris,G., (undated), AnthropogenicImpacts on Coastal Lakes and Lagoons; and the National Land andWater Resources Audit.

Page 27: Coastal Lakes - dpi.nsw.gov.au · Coastal Council to undertake the tasks specified in Section 9.2. 3. Establish processes to resolve disputes that might arise in the preparation of

Independent Public Inquiry into Coastal Lakes: Final ReportHealthy Rivers Commission of New South Wales

21

Management Plans for individual coastal lakes, toaddress any local or unique ecosystem and humanuse requirements.

Public authorities must use their judgement, withinthe boundaries set by the management framework,to determine the timing and intensity ofimplementation of specific actions designed toprotect and restore any given coastal lake. Thosedecisions must have regard to considerations ofurgency and priority, cost effectiveness, naturalresource capabilities, opportunities, impacts oncitizens, and the relationships of possible actionswith other, existing, management initiatives anduses of funds and other resources.

The framework for managing coastal lakes ispresented in Tables 1 - 4. Each table addresses oneclass of coastal lake, the types of outcomes soughtand indicative actions that would be typicallyimplemented. A range of management tools arepresented in Table 5.

6.1 Application of the Framework in Practice

The framework provides clear guidance to publicauthorities in their decision making processesrelating to coastal lakes. For each class of coastallake, it indicates the typical types of actionsnecessary, and how the relevant powers must beexercised, to achieve the outcomes sought for eachclass of coastal lake. That is, for each class ofcoastal lake it establishes ‘boundaries’ of discretion,within which the lake managers (councils andagencies), together with citizens, may determine thedetailed actions for an individual lake, in light of itsspecific local circumstances and priorities.

Managers' discretion in determining outcomes andactions for specific lakes is greatest for those coastallakes classified as Healthy Modified Conditions,given the potential capability of many such systemsto sustain some further development, and often, thepresence of human factors that entrench theirstatus. However, the degree of discretion will belimited in some cases, for example in creek linesand foreshore areas and in poorly flushedembayments, for which particularly carefulplanning and management will be essential.

The specific outcomes to be determined for eachlake in this classification will provide greaterdirection for managers. For example, adoption of‘maintenance of the conditions needed for growingoysters’ as an essential outcome for Wallis Lakewould immediately establish some managementpriorities and directions for that lake.

The coastal lakes that are in the SignificantProtection class warrant more stringent

management, in order to contain the risks posed bya variety of existing and potential activities. Theextent of management discretion must besomewhat less for this class of coastal lake becausethe options are narrower, if lake health is to bemaintained and/or restored.

Management discretion is inevitably narroweragain for coastal lakes classified as Targeted Repairand Comprehensive Protection. Coastal lakes inthe Targeted Repair class are typically situated inhighly urbanised catchments and are significantlydegraded. Therefore opportunities to improvetheir natural ecosystems are often highlyconstrained to the 'art of the possible'. Nonetheless,many of those lakes are of high importance to localcitizens, and management efforts must be directedtowards identifying key rehabilitation options, suchas protecting selected species, managing entranceopenings, aerating water bodies and implementingimproved stormwater controls.

Finally, management discretion for coastal lakes inthe Comprehensive Protection class is constrainedby the overriding intention to protect the health ofthese pristine/near pristine and/or highly sensitivelakes and their catchments. There is no choice butto manage such coastal lakes within tightlyconfined parameters. Thus the actions that areproposed for such coastal lakes, such as ‘limitingany new development to within the existingboundaries of developed urban or rural residentialareas’ are often explicit and necessarily prescriptive.Some such actions can be identified immediatelywhile others, such as those to manage thebehaviour of lake entrances and those intended topromote adoption of best farming practices, mayrequire time, further assessment and negotiationbefore being fully formulated.8

Specific detail is provided in Section 11 regardingapplication of the framework to two key matters,lake entrance management and new development.

8 Many of the actions to achieve Comprehensive Protection

would be relatively simple to implement immediately becausethe relevant coastal lakes are often situated, fully or in largepart, within national parks or previous government decisionshave paved the way (eg the responses to planning Commissionsof Inquiry, court decisions and forestry agreements in manycatchments).

7 Classification of CoastalLakes

Classifying coastal lakes is a first step towards theidentification of a set of realistic goals for each lakeand a management plan able to achieve them costeffectively. The framework provides that after theinitial classification, the processes of preparingSustainability Assessment and Management Plans(according to the guidelines provided for eachclass of lake) will help to clarify a lake’scapabilities and refine the goals in that light, andto identify the management actions most likely toachieve the goals.

Each coastal lake has been assessed and classified(within a state level classification system),according to how it 'rates' on several factors. Thefactors include a lake's natural sensitivity, thecurrent condition of the water body andcatchment, and recognised ecosystem and resourceconservation values. Other significant factors usedto inform the classifications include existingpatterns of settlement and natural resource use,key government or court decisions, the potentialfor restoration or rehabilitation, and opportunitiesfor and constraints on development around othercoastal lakes and estuaries within a region. (Referto Appendix 4 for further details.)

The judgements underlying the assessments andclassifications are influenced by the availability ofrelevant information, which is often limited formany coastal lakes. In particular, theclassifications have been informed by datacollected and analysed by the Department of Landand Water Conservation in its Estuaries Inventory(which draws on the results of estuary studies)and on the information collated under theCommonwealth Government's National Land andWater Resources Audit: Estuaries Program. Someadditional data have been obtained fromuniversities, independent experts, other stateagencies and local councils.

This information has been augmented by thatsupplied in submissions to the Coastal LakesInquiry, where it has been possible to validate thesignificance and effect of such information. TheHealthy Rivers Commission applied itsindependent judgement to determine theclassifications, particularly in situations in whichconflicting expectations about the use of a coastallake require a balanced assessment and decision,or where there is limited information.

Table 6 presents the classifications for the coastallakes covered by the Coastal Lakes Strategy. A'provisional' classification has been assigned to afew coastal lakes, for example, St Georges Basin

and Wallaga Lake, given that the limited availableinformation suggests that these lakes lie on theborderline between two different classifications.In all cases, the findings of SustainabilityAssessment and Management Plans will be used toconfirm these classifications, or to suggest anyreclassifications.

8 Sustainability Assessment andManagement Plans

Sustainability Assessment and Management Plansare pivotal components of the Coastal LakesStrategy. Each assessment and plan will determineand record any other outcomes sought for a givencoastal lake (in addition to those specified in thestrategy), its capability and limitations to sustainexisting and likely human activities, the actions tobe implemented (including remedial actions), andthe most appropriate selection and design ofmanagement tools.

That is, the assessments and plans will specify theactions to be taken by state agencies, and criteriafor them to satisfy in exercising their statutoryapprovals functions, in the delivery of programsand in setting parameters for funding andresourcing. The Sustainability Assessment andManagement Plans will also lead to thespecification of explicit provisions in councils’local environmental plans.

The assessments will enable local councils andstate agencies to make better decisions about thedevelopment and management actions that aresustainable for each coastal lake. That is, thefindings would provide a key basis for decisionsabout whether, or to what extent, a proposedactivity with potential impacts on a coastal lakeshould occur. An activity might, for example, be'permitted or encouraged', 'permitted subject toconditions', 'not permitted, pending furtherinvestigations' or 'not permitted'.

The classification of lakes within the frameworkprovides the context for the work of localcouncil(s) and state agencies in preparingSustainability Assessment and Management Plans.The management orientation for each class ofcoastal lake, together with any other specificoutcomes sought would influence the nature andscope of an assessment for a specified lake.

For example, assessments for coastal lakesclassified as Comprehensive Protection wouldfocus on identifying the actions required forrestoring and preserving natural processes. Incomparison, the assessment for coastal lakesclassified as Targeted Repair might focus on theconditions needed by selected species and how tosustain them, or on the factors that are creatingadverse events, such as algal blooms, and ways ofmitigating them. Figure 1 presents an illustratedexample of a component of an assessment for acoastal lake in the Healthy Modified Conditionclass.

Lake specific assessments are to be based on thefollowing key factors:

• key ecosystem processes and thresholds (eglake type & maturity, entrance behaviour,nutrient loads, lake hydraulics, flooding, sealevel and storm intensity change);

• catchment processes (eg soils, vegetation, riverflows);

• environmental and ecosystem values (eg waterquality and river flow objectives, threatenedspecies, representativeness, wetlands, aquaticand terrestrial weeds);

• Aboriginal values (eg access, food, spiritual,Native Title claims);

• sustainable (commercial) resource use andvalues (eg fish, oysters, tourism, forestry,boating, farming, water extraction, mining,aquaculture);

• citizen values (eg heritage, recreation,amenity, odours, fire hazard);

• public health implications of lake conditions(eg swimming, oyster cultivation andconsumption, drinking water); and

• existing and possible public and privateinstitutional, jurisdictional and managementmechanisms, which could be used toimplement actions.

Existing estuary, flood, forestry, river flow,fisheries, sewage, stormwater, boating, soils,vegetation and other relevant studies (includingthose in progress) will provide valuable inputs inthe preparation of Sustainability Assessment andManagement Plans. Particular attention should begiven to ascertaining the extent to which otherexisting initiatives (such as current regionalforestry agreements, fisheries controls and estuarymanagement studies and plans) might meet therequirements of the assessment and managementplans.

In some cases, decisions will need to be made onthe basis of limited information and ‘bestjudgements’ about the likely impacts of variousactivities. The framework provides guidance to theappropriate approach to risk management. Thatis, the closer a coastal lake is to the ComprehensiveProtection end of the continuum, the more precisethe risk management strategies will need to be andthe clearer the signals for action in response to anydeviation from the expected results. For coastal

Page 37: Coastal Lakes - dpi.nsw.gov.au · Coastal Council to undertake the tasks specified in Section 9.2. 3. Establish processes to resolve disputes that might arise in the preparation of

Independent Public Inquiry into Coastal Lakes: Final ReportHealthy Rivers Commission of New South Wales

31

lakes closer to Targeted Repair, a higher level ofrisk could be accepted.

If activities are judged to result in ‘tolerable’ (iesustainable) impacts on lakes, the basis for thosejudgements and the resulting decisions, must bemade clear. Unless there is virtual certainty thatthe impacts will remain within the tolerable range,some risk management or ‘damage control’measures should be specified in advance, withagreed triggers for their implementation.

Some benchmarks must be specified in advancefor this purpose. These would be the referencepoints against which subsequent monitoring couldconfirm (or otherwise) that the outcomes arewithin the anticipated range. Results outside therange would signal a need for previous decisionsto be reviewed and the plan and actions possiblyto be adapted. The process provides for earlyattention to any adverse impacts, as well asgenerating information on which to base futuredecisions.

In all cases, the Sustainability Assessment andManagement Plans would identify the publicauthorities or private entities that are responsiblefor each specified action and the timing (includingcritical milestones and completion dates) andallocation of resources relevant to itsimplementation.

8.1 Aboriginal Values and Significance

A key component of each SustainabilityAssessment and Management Plan relates toAboriginal values and significance.

A desktop assessment of known Aboriginal values(eg access and use) and significance9, is to beundertaken by the key state agencies, drawing onavailable information, including local councilknowledge and archival information. Priorityinterests and outcomes will be tentativelyidentified from this assessment, to guide furtherconsultation with Aboriginal communities, toascertain the validity and completeness of theinitial assessment. (It is essential that adequatetime is provided for this consultation.)

This approach will serve as a pilot for Aboriginalconsultation and involvement as part of the

9 The importance of a place to Aboriginal peoples is not

limited to cultural heritage 'items'. It includes other mattersassociated with spiritual and utilitarian significance such asaccess to traditional foods, medicinal plants and token faunaand flora. Some knowledge about these matters may begained from a review of historical records of early settlers andexplorers.

Comprehensive Coastal Assessment for the remainderof the coastal zone. This will assist in fulfilling theGovernment’s decision, as part of its CoastalProtection Package, to investigate and enhanceconsultation with Aboriginal communities andtheir participation in coastal management.

8.2 Site Specific Assessments

The Sustainability Assessment and ManagementPlan prepared for each coastal lake will create thecontext for more detailed site assessments forspecific development proposals. The proponentsof development proposals will undertake suchassessments, thereby fulfilling (or partiallyfulfilling) their existing obligations to preparevarious types of environment impact assessments.

Site assessments will be directed towardsdemonstrating how a particular developmentproposal would satisfy performance conditionsspecified in the management plan and assist inachieving the intended outcomes. Thoseassessments will provide the basis for council andagency decisions on the detailed design features ofa proposed development, including mitigativeand/or the best methods or approaches tomanaging the development. The findings of siteassessments will also contribute to ongoingprocesses of confirmation or fine-tuning of theSustainability Assessment and Management Plan.

Figure 1: Sustainability Assessment: An Illustrated Example

Extreme risk - no developmentHigh risk - no septics or sewer overflows

Moderate risk - stringent controls on on-site systemsLow risk - standard controls

Oyster leases nearwell flushed entrance

Oyster lease in poorlyflushed embayment

OCEAN

Consider an assessment for a coastal lake with a management orientation of Healthy Modified Conditions,with an outcome to provide minimal risk to oyster growing. A critical aspect of the assessment would involveidentifying areas in which on-site sewage disposal would present high risks, such as sites with unsuitablesoils, in close proximity to oyster leases or draining to poorly flushed embayments. It also would identify lowrisk areas, such as those with suitable soils located away from oysters or where the water body is well flushed.

Such findings would be incorporated as provisions into local environmental plans to exclude on-site disposalin high risk areas and permit it in lower risk areas (subject to appropriate design and operational controls).Adaptive management would ensure that regular feedback led to necessary adjustments in controls andprocedures.

Similarly, the Sustainability Assessment and Management Plan would identify and address other critical usesof the lake and catchment (eg areas subject to flooding, sewage effluent disposal from boats and fishingpractices).

10.2 Managing Lake Entrances: RegulatoryProcesses

The Coastal Lakes Inquiry found that it is commonpractice to open the entrances of many coastal lakesartificially, with inadequate or no assessment ormonitoring of the impacts on lake ecosystems ordependent human activities. Management is often‘ad hoc’ and even where arrangements for openingcoastal lakes have been agreed, these are sometimesdisregarded. The current statutory arrangementsgoverning entrance openings also involve multipleoverlapping instruments, including the CrownLands Act 1989, State Environment Planning Policy 35

- Maintenance Dredging of Tidal Waterways26,Environmental Planning and Assessment Act 1979,Fisheries Management Act 1994 and the WaterManagement Act 2000.

The Coastal Lakes Strategy provides for moreeffective regulatory processes that require allrelevant public authorities to assess, monitor andreview the impacts of artificially opening lakeentrances on both lake ecosystems and dependenthuman uses, as well as ensure that publicauthorities comply with decisions. Specifically, the‘controlled activity’ provisions of the WaterManagement Act 2000, to commence in July 2002,represent the most appropriate mechanism forgoverning decisions to open lake entrancesartificially.

Application of this mechanism must provide for:

• decisions to approve entrance openings to besubject to approvals that are informed by andconsistent with the findings of SustainabilityAssessment and Management Plans;

• an agreed entrance opening regime (ie a seriesof opening events over time), given the need toensure that councils can respond promptlywhen protection is needed for assets subject towater damage and/or public healthrequirements;

• a program of actions to reinstate (partially orfully) the natural entrance behaviour, in thosecases for which lake specific SustainabilityAssessment and Management Plans determinethis to be practicable and necessary; and

• an education strategy to increase communityunderstanding and acceptance of entrancemanagement strategies.

Arrangements for managing the entrance of anindividual coastal lake would be subject toapproval by the Minister for Land and WaterConservation and the Minister for Planning, as partof their approval of Sustainability Assessment andManagement Plans.

With improvement of the assessment andregulatory processes for coastal lakes, StateEnvironmental Planning Policy 35 should beamended to exclude its application to themanagement of coastal lake entrances.

26 One of the key recommendations from the ICOLLs

(Intermittently Closed and Open Lakes and Lagoons) Forum(1998) held by the Coastal Council was the need to review theprovisions and application of SEPP35.

10.3 Adapting to Changes in Sea Level and Storm Events

Councils and agencies have adopted different'standards', or in some cases no standard, to guidetheir planning responses to predicted rises in sealevel27 and resultant rises in the levels of lakewater28 or entrance sand plugs. 29 Even a modestrise in sea level might be enough to cause floodingof some existing assets in low-lying areas aroundseveral coastal lakes, such as Lake Tabourie30.Similarly, predicted changes in the intensity ofstorm events may exacerbate existing risks or createnew ones.31 Any new approvals to locate assetsprone to water damage or inconvenience in lowlying areas could increase the potential risks andcosts and further entrench existing pressures toopen the entrances of some lake entrances orintervene in others. A more precautionaryapproach is warranted.

The Coastal Lakes Strategy requires that early actionis taken to assess the social, economic andecosystem risks that may result from a rise in sealevel and change in storm events for coastal lakes(and other coastal areas); and to formulatecommensurate management responses. The latterwould require all public authorities to adopt acommon approach for a predicted rise in sea (andlake) water level in all their planning andmanagement activities relating to coastal lakes,particularly for any new developments.

PlanningNSW would incorporate assessments andresponses into the Comprehensive Coastal Assessment.

27 The CSIRO estimates that sea level is projected to rise by 9 to

88 centimetres by 2100, or 0.8 to 8.0 centimetres per decade,with regional variations. The observed rise over the 20th

Century was 1 to 2 centimetres per decade. (CSIRO, 2001,Climate Change: Projections for Australia, Canberra).28 Water levels in open coastal lakes are typically higher than

sea level due to the processes of tidal conveyance. That is, morewater enters a lake entrance during high ocean tides than exitsduring low tides.29 The 1999-2000 Annual Report of the Coastal Council provides

a summary of council responses to sea level changes.30 The entrance of Lake Tabourie is currently opened when lake

water levels reach a height of 1.17 metres Australian HeightDatum (Shoalhaven City Council, 1999, Draft Lake TabourieEntrance Management Policy and Review of Environmental Factors).31 CSIRO, 2001, Climate Change: Projections for Australia,

Canberra.

10.4 Establishing Reserves

The establishment of reserves represents animportant tool for ensuring the long-termprotection of important coastal lakes and theircatchments.

For many coastal lakes classified as ComprehensiveProtection, much of the catchment and water bodyis already within a reserve. For protection of theremaining areas, the relevant state agency musttake immediate action to declare the lake body andbeds as reserves under the provisions of theNational Parks and Wildlife Act 1974 (lake bed), theMarine Parks Act 1997 or the Crown LandsManagement Act 1989.

Additionally, specific areas of Crown land (within alake catchment or comprising a lake bed) in anyclass of coastal lake, identified through theSustainability Assessments as having outstandingconservation values, must be afforded appropriateprotection, through its declaration as a reserve bythe relevant agency.

10.5 Protecting Ecosystems through Land Acquisition

The Coastal Lands Protection Scheme is a valuablestate program that provides funds for the purchaseof selected private properties with important assets,traditionally related to scenic, access and recreationvalues.

The criteria for acquisition of private lands underthe Coastal Lands Protection Scheme should beadjusted by PlanningNSW to allow also for thepurchase of properties (or parts of properties) thatwould indirectly improve or protect the health ofcoastal lakes and their catchments. This isconsistent with the intent of recent amendments tothe program criteria to include acquisition ofproperties to link coastal reserves, secure areas ofhabitat/ conservation value and protect estuaries.

A modest, one off enhancement of the fundingallocated to the program would permit thepurchase of the few key properties likely to beidentified in the priority Sustainability Assessmentand Management Plans.32 The broader review offunding of all coastal land acquisition programs,being undertaken as part of the Coastal ProtectionPackage should address those opportunities.

32 For example, it would be possible to counter the need to openor substantially raise the water level at which Coila Lake isopened artificially to the ocean, hence protecting extensive andvaluable ecosystems around the lake edge, by purchasing acouple of residential blocks and a few hectares of a farm.

10.8 Managing Caulerpa Taxifolia

The aquatic weed Caulerpa taxifolia presents asignificant threat to the ecosystems of coastal lakesand their dependent human activities. NSWFisheries and other public authorities haveimplemented several actions to investigate theweed's behaviour and to better manage it, throughprohibiting its sale, controlling fishing andeducating citizens.

Efforts to investigate the impacts of the weed oncoastal lakes (and other estuaries) must be furtherstrengthened, particularly with regard toidentifying its preferred environmental conditions,spread and control. The possible need foradditional State funds to be allocated for thispurpose will require consideration.

In the interim, pending the outcomes of the aboveinvestigations and preparation of a longer termstrategy, as part of the implementation of thisCoastal Lakes Strategy, action is required to containthe spread of the weed both within and betweenestuaries, such as through appropriate andconsistent management of boating and fishingactivities.

Any future strategy to manage this weed mustinclude cost-effective actions to mitigate any humaninduced environmental conditions that favour itsgrowth, for example, nutrient inflows fromcatchment activities. Additionally, any controlactions, for example, opening the entrances ofcoastal lakes, must be assessed carefully anddesigned to avoid any possible outcomes that mightpresent greater threats to lake ecosystems anddependent human uses.36

11.1 Managing Lake Entrances: DecisionMaking

Many coastal lakes are, or would be, intermittentlyopen and closed, (some being mostly open andothers mostly closed) as a result of naturalprocesses. In general, the condition of many coastallake ecosystems would be improved if there were amore natural pattern of opening and closing.42

Human intervention in the behaviour of lakeentrances occurs for a variety of reasons. Acommon reason is to mitigate any potential damage,health risks and/or inconvenience to low lying

39 The opportunities for such exchanges on a broad scale have

been reduced as a result of Government action to dedicatesubstantial areas of Crown Land as park reserves (in light oftheir direct ecological value). However, such opportunitiesshould be assessed on a lake by lake basis, in areas wheresuitable Crown Land is available.40 Such a mechanism is foreshadowed in the draft Sustaining the

Catchments Regional Plan (DUAP, 2000), and noted in PlanFirst(DUAP, 2001).41 Several paper subdivisions exist along the NSW coast,

including a parcel of land in the catchment of LakeWollumboola.42 Opening the entrances of coastal lakes artificially has

profound adverse impacts on lake ecosystems, such as throughchanges in salinity regimes and patterns of water inundation inwetlands. However, little research has been undertaken todevelop a better understanding of the ecological processes andfull consequences of such interventions.

properties and other assets, such as yards, accessroads, septic tanks and homes, when water levels ina closed coastal lake are high.43 The need to opencoastal lakes for this reason is the result of poorplanning decisions in the past. Some coastal lakesare also opened to 'improve' lake amenity byalleviating actual or perceived water qualityproblems or to create preferred conditions, such asthose relating to odours, swimming, recreationalfishing, boating, irrigation and foreshoreconditions.

There are some circumstances where opening lakeentrances may be warranted. However, such actiontypically has occurred regardless of the significantdifferences in the ecological condition, conservationand resource values (natural and/or dependententerprises), the type and scale of human assetssubject to water inundation or changes in waterquality, and with inadequate or no assessment ormonitoring of the impacts. Thus a near pristinecoastal lake with few affected assets, such as DurrasLake, has too frequently been treated in the sameway as a degraded lake with multiple affectedassets where opening represents a 'last resort', suchas Terrigal Lagoon. Management is often ‘ad hoc’and even where arrangements for opening coastallakes have been agreed, these have beendisregarded sometimes (eg Lake Cathie).

Careful and balanced examination of the impacts ofopening entrances artificially on a coastal lake'secosystem and its existing dependent uses, relativeto the actual risks to assets or water quality, todetermine what action is cost effective and overwhat timeframe is required. It may be appropriate,cost effective and achievable to raise or modifyselected existing assets immediately or over timeand/or 'live' with higher lake water levels.44

The framework for managing coastal lakesprovides for orderly decision making by publicauthorities in respect of interventions in the naturalprocesses of lakes’ entrances. It requires that thosedecisions are consistent with the outcomes soughtfor each class of coastal lake.

• For the majority of the coastal lakes classified asComprehensive Protection, there is noinsurmountable reason not to discontinue

43 In some cases, it must be recognised that local council action

is likely to be necessary to mitigate the risks associated withsubstantial flooding (eg 1 in 100 year event), regardless ofwhether or not an entrance is opened artificially.44 For example, Great Lakes Council has initiated action, in

conjunction with affected parties, to raise the level at whichSmiths Lake is opened. In particular, the operator of a caravanpark has adapted to higher water level events and council hasinstalled reticulated sewerage in some local villages. Counciladvises that the entrance behaviour of Smiths Lake could bereinstated to near natural conditions, if a jetty and tea house onCrown Land were raised at modest cost.

Page 52: Coastal Lakes - dpi.nsw.gov.au · Coastal Council to undertake the tasks specified in Section 9.2. 3. Establish processes to resolve disputes that might arise in the preparation of

Independent Public Inquiry into Coastal Lakes: Final ReportHealthy Rivers Commission of New South Wales

46

artificial entrance openings, given that these areoften largely or fully within national parks.Durras Lake, is an illustrative case.

• For coastal lakes classified as SignificantProtection, it should be possible to minimiseintervention in entrance behaviour in the shortterm. In many cases, this is likely to requiremodest, cost effective actions, such as ‘renting’farmland that is inundated by water or raisinga section of a local road to avoid inundation.Such actions could often be achieved throughbetter direction of existing funds. It may bepossible to further raise or even reinstate fullythe natural entrance regime over the longerterm.

• For coastal lakes classified as Healthy ModifiedConditions or Targeted Repair, present landuse and economic implications typicallyremove the possibility of returning to a naturalentrance regime. In some cases, humanmodification of these coastal lakes andcatchments is such that there is often littlechoice but to open entrances to improve lakehealth. However, it may be possible to makesome adjustments to current practices foropening entrances to protect selected natural ormodified ecosystem processes. Where openingan entrance represents a last resort approach toimproving water quality, application of theframework would ensure that catchmentimprovements received earlier and morestringent attention, so that the water qualityproblems are better contained at source.

Detailed decisions about entrance management forindividual coastal lakes would be determined in thecourse of preparing Sustainability Assessment andManagement Plans. However, a requirement forany new assets that would otherwise be prone towater damage or inconvenience to be set abovehigh lake water levels (under natural entranceconditions) is a commonsense approach thatwarrants immediate adoption. A possibleexception might apply for a few of the coastal lakesclassified as Targeted Repair or Healthy ModifiedConditions where there are strong grounds formaintaining an open entrance condition over thelong term.

11.2 Undertaking New Development

The framework provides opportunities for certainforms of new development45, even for those coastallakes in the Comprehensive Protection class. A

45 The term 'development' is used in a broad way, rather than

listing the many specific types of activities that are used byplanners or derived from legislation.

number of villages have been established within thecatchments of several such lakes and that theseplaces are often valued highly by members of localcommunities and visitors.46 Whilst expansion ofthese villages would impact adversely on theecosystems of such coastal lakes, the frameworkwould not preclude citizens’ undertaking activitiessuch as home building within the existing boundariesof developed urban and rural residential areas,subject to appropriate conditions.

Additionally, the framework would allow for some'sustainable' developments, even outside existingdeveloped areas, in the catchments of coastal lakesin the Comprehensive Protection class. Forexample, it is reasonable to expect that basic visitorfacilities of the type found in many national parksand reserves could be provided, given adequateenvironmental safeguards to ensure that theintended outcomes remained achievable. In suchcases, the test would be whether new developmentsare likely to have a neutral or beneficial effect onlake or catchment health. Such an approach isconsistent with the NSW Government'sdevelopment and piloting of 'green offsets', asdescribed in its Action for the Environment Statement.

Similarly, the framework would allow thedevelopment of eco-tourism facilities and activities(eg education centres and retreats) around coastallakes classified as Significant Protection. Itrecognises that such developments may bedesirable means of ensuring that some coastal lakesare used in ways that contribute more to the socialand economic well being of regional communities,provide incentives for existing land holders topursue alternative business opportunities, andgenerate a broader set of interests dedicated toprotecting lake health over the longer term. In suchcases, the emphasis would be on developmentswhere any potential minor impacts can be containedon site.

However, effective management requires that suchapproaches are carefully evaluated and not used asa convenient loop-hole to gain approval of highimpact developments under the guise of 'greendevelopment' or with 'green trappings'. Theframework’s processes for assessing the capabilitiesand limitations of individual coastal lakes,including independent expert validation, wouldassist the identification of developments that couldaccurately be described as ‘sustainable’ in a givensituation.

46 Well known examples include Culburra and North Durras in

the catchments of Wollumboola and Durras lakes, respectively.

Appendix 4: Classification of Coastal Lakes

A state wide classification system for coastal lakes is an integral component of the Coastal Lakes Strategy.Within the classification system, the following broad factors influence the class to which an individual coastallake is assigned:

• inherent natural sensitivity to human activities (eg potential pollutant inflows, flushing capacity, entrancebehaviour);

• existing condition of the catchment and lake water body (eg extent of land clearing, potential impacts ofdifferent land uses and occurrence of water quality problems and fish kills); and

• 'recognised' natural and resource conservation values (eg presence of threatened species, ecosystemuniqueness and representativeness, commercial values, reserves).

The Healthy Rivers Commission has drawn, in particular, upon the data collected and analysed by theDepartment of Land and Water Conservation in its Estuaries Inventory (incorporating information obtainedthrough estuary studies), and on the information collated under the Commonwealth Government's NationalLand and Water Audit: Theme Seven - Estuaries Program. Some additional data have been obtained fromuniversities, independent experts, other state agencies, local councils and material provided in submissions.The Commission emphasises that the terms used to describe the status of each factor for a particular lake arerelative to those for all other coastal lakes.

In light of comments made in submissions and meetings with technical specialists from key state agencies, theCommission has further enhanced the process for assessing some of these factors. For example, the relevantinformation from the fish kill database has been used to inform the lake condition factor. The method forassessing inherent natural sensitivity has been altered to assign a greater weighting to the lake entrancecondition, and less to the maturity (degree of basin infilling) of the lake. Additionally, Aboriginal significancehas been removed from the assessment of conservation value, given comments from the Department ofAboriginal Affairs and the National Parks and Wildlife Service that all lakes have significance for Aboriginalcommunities, and a more detailed, local assessment is needed to assign lake specific value.

The classification system also incorporates a range of other more qualitative, but significant factors that mightinfluence the class to which an individual coastal lake is assigned. These factors include:

• data confidence, given the often limited technical information available;

• information on other natural resource factors that might affect the condition of a lake's ecosystem (eg soiltype, shape and depth of a lake's basin);

• material provided in submissions;

• existing patterns of regional settlement, natural resources use, recreation and tourism and theirsustainability;

• critical decisions made by government (federal, state and local), courts and planning Commissions ofInquiry;

• potential for restoration of natural ecosystem processes or rehabilitation of modified ecosystem processes;and

• the potential classification of a coastal lake with regard to classifications assigned to nearby lakes, as wellas consideration of the likely capability, condition and pressures on other estuaries.

The Commission has classified each coastal lake using the classification system, which, in accordance with themanagement framework, indicates the management orientation for each lake, as shown in Table A2.

The Commission has used its judgement in determining the classifications for coastal lakes, with regard to thepotential applicability of the types of actions presented in the framework for managing different classes of

Page 77: Coastal Lakes - dpi.nsw.gov.au · Coastal Council to undertake the tasks specified in Section 9.2. 3. Establish processes to resolve disputes that might arise in the preparation of

Independent Public Inquiry into Coastal Lakes: Final ReportHealthy Rivers Commission of New South Wales

71

coastal lake. In particular, the Commission has considered the results of its broad assessment of the abovefactors in aggregate, in considering where the public interest might be in cases where a more restrictiveapproach to managing a coastal lake might seem desirable, but may be premature prior to more detailedassessment. In these cases, the interests of lake health and affected parties are likely to be best served throughearly preparation of Sustainability Assessment and Management Plans (of the type recommended for coastallakes classified as Healthy Modified Conditions) to determine the capabilities and limitations of each lake tosustain existing and potential development. This may confirm the classification assigned to a coastal lake orinform a decision to reclassify and demonstrate the reasons for such action. The Commission also emphasisesthat some areas within coastal lakes classified as Healthy Modified Conditions will require more carefulmanagement and planning, such as those surrounding embayments that are poorly flushed. Thus two lakesthat have similar or the same broad descriptions, might be assigned to different classes.

The judgements underlying the classifications are also influenced by data availability, which is limited formany of the coastal lakes. For example, it has been necessary to adjust the natural sensitivity descriptions forseveral coastal lakes because of fundamental changes in the available data relating to the size of their'catchment area'. The revised areas, which should be confirmed again when Sustainability Assessments areundertaken, have a significant bearing on the potential pollutant load entering a lake and hence a key aspectof a lake's natural sensitivity to human activities. In finalising the Coastal Lakes Inquiry, the Commission hasobtained additional data to fill some gaps, and confirmed the accuracy of some existing data.

The fact that information on the ecological, social and economic characteristics and importance of manycoastal lakes is inadequate necessitates the approach adopted by the Commission. Thus, the classificationassigned to each coastal lake should be confirmed through the Sustainability Assessment process. A rigorousprocess is recommended to consider and approve any reclassification.

A working paper that presents more detail about the classification system and the information used to classifyeach coastal lake is available from the Healthy Rivers Commission upon request.
